‘consumption Of Tiger Nuts Stimulates immune System’ by princesammmy: 3:38pm On Jul 15, 2013
A nutritionist at the Wuse General Hospital
Abuja, Hajiya Jummai Abdul, has said that tiger
nuts help to stimulate the immune system by
preventing cardiovascular diseases, stroke and
cancer.
Abdul told the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) in
Abuja on Monday that the nuts had essential
minerals such as calcium, magnesium and
iron.
She said that the minerals were used to build
strong bones and muscles; repaired tissues
and helped the blood stream.
“Tiger nuts are often cultivated for its edible
tubers.
‘’ In Nigeria, the Hausas call it ‘Aya’; Yorubas
call it ‘Ofio’; the Igbos, ‘imumu’ or ‘aki Hausa’;
while the Hausas make a drink called Kunun
Aya from it,’’ she said.
According to her, in China, tiger nut juice was
used as a liver tonic and heart stimulant.
Abdul said that the nuts contained a lot of oleic
acid which helped to reduce cholesterol and
triglyceride, adding that it also prevented
hardening of the arteries.
She explained that it helped to prevent
constipation because it aided proper digestion.
